1 #############################
3 # Request erp5 development environnment
5 #############################
8 extends = ${template-zope:output}
17 eggs-directory = ${buildout:eggs-directory}
18 develop-eggs-directory = ${buildout:develop-eggs-directory}
22 recipe = slapos.cookbook:erp5.update
25 url = http://$${zope-instance:user}:$${zope-instance:password}@$${zope-instance:ip}:$${zope-instance:port}/
26 mysql-url = $${request-mariadb:connection-url}
27 kumofs-url = $${request-kumofs:connection-url}
28 memcached-url = $${request-memcached:connection-url}
29 cloudooo-url = $${request-cloudooo:connection-url}
30 site-id = $${slap-parameter:site-id}
31 openssl-binary = ${openssl:location}/bin/openssl
32 cadir-path = $${erp5-certificate-authority:ca-dir}
35 update-wrapper = $${basedirectory:services}/erp5-update
38 configurator-bt5-list = erp5_core_proxy_field_legacy erp5_full_text_myisam_catalog erp5_base erp5_workflow erp5_configurator erp5_configurator_standard erp5_configurator_maxma_demo erp5_configurator_ung
39 bt5-repository-list = $${zope-instance:bt5-repository-list}
41 recipe = slapos.cookbook:request
42 software-url = $${slap-connection:software-release-url}
44 sla-computer_guid = $${slap-connection:computer-id}
46 server-url = $${slap-connection:server-url}
47 key-file = $${slap-connection:key-file}
48 cert-file = $${slap-connection:cert-file}
49 computer-id = $${slap-connection:computer-id}
50 partition-id = $${slap-connection:partition-id}
54 name = MariaDB DataBase
55 software-type = mariadb
60 software-type = cloudooo
65 software-type = memcached
70 software-type = kumofs
72 # rest of parts are candidates for some generic stuff
74 recipe = slapos.cookbook:mkdirectory
75 services = $${rootdirectory:etc}/run/
78 recipe = slapos.cookbook:mkdirectory
79 etc = $${buildout:directory}/etc/